Another fine one pass shave in the books, this time with the Chinese Super Blue Razor and a Chinese Super Blue Blade.
The handle that comes with the Super Blue razor is a crummy piece of plastic and metal, so I made a GTB Midget handle for it.
It is the same weight as most of my vintage Gillette razor handles(24.7grams) and is 12.3mm x 78mm.
Tapped for 10-32 threads, it will fit my vintage Gillette, Karve, and Fatip razors, but not my modern razors with an M5 thread.

I found the Super Blue razor to be slightly more comfortable and efficient than my New LC and there was no need for an extra ATG pass on my neck.
The razor did play a nice song as it hummed through 24 hours of stubble and was very easy on my neck.

The Witch hazel felt nice, the Skin Bracer refreshing, and the Nivea balm a nice finishing touch. I'll definitely need to shave again soon.
Next up is my 1967 Tech (M4) which the Super Blue razor is patterned after to get an honest opinion of the two razors.

NOTES: I purchased a Nablus soap block because I saw a YouTube video of this ancient soap being made in Palastine of just olive oil, lye, and water. This was purchased for showing but I searched then to see if it could be used for shaving and found yes, so I tried it. I have to say this is the best shave I've had. This soap was slicker than anything I have used (only about a dozen or so pucks/soaps/creams). I had a BBS+ shave:

Decided to do a side-by-side to compare the TanZ & B13. Both have very little gel, are super soft, have a low backbone, and have a luxurious cloud-like feel. The B13 has a bit more backbone and is denser. Both are easy to load and release lather easily.
